"Spirit Reaper" is only destroyed by its own effect if it is face-up on the field when the effect designating it as a target activates' date=' AND after the effect designating it as a target resolves. If you Special Summon "Spirit Reaper" with Monster Reborn, or flip it face-down with "Book of Moon", or flip it face-up with "Book of Taiyou", it is not destroyed.[/quote']

Reaper > Marsh > Fool

 

I personally like Marshy a bit more, but Reaper is still better.

 

Spirit Reaper:

PROS: Makes opponent discard, allureable, zombie, can't be destroyed in battle.

CONS: Destroyed if targeted.

 

Marshmallon:

PROS: Can't be destroyed in battle, inflicts 1000 if attacked while face-down.

CONS: Almost always in defense, easily destroyed by Sheild Crush; Smashing Ground; Fissure; etc.

 

The Fool:

PROS: If tails, can't be targeted by opponent.

CONS: 50/50 effect.
